Re‐reading of OraQuick HIV‐1/2 rapid antibody test results: quality assurance implications for HIV self‐testing programmes
INTRODUCTION: Scale‐up of HIV self‐testing (HIVST) will play a key role in meeting the United Nation's 90‐90‐90 targets. Delayed re‐reading of used HIVST devices has been used by early implementation studies to validate the performance of self‐test kits and to estimate HIV positivity among self...
